Silent Invaders: Identifying Secret Water Leaks

Water leaks can be sneaky, often remaining unknown until they cause significant damage. These subtle invaders can inflict harm on your property, leading to costly repairs and future health hazards.

Spotting leaks promptly is crucial to reduce the impact of water damage. Regular inspections of your pipes can help expose even small leaks before they escalate.

Saving Water, Saving Money: The Importance of Leak Detection

A seemingly trivial leak can quickly become a major problem for your wallet. Each dripping faucet or leaking pipe consumes valuable water, pushing your monthly utility expenses through the ceiling. Stop these unwanted costs and protect our vital water resources by taking the initiative with leak detection. Regularly inspect your fixtures for any indications of a leak.

Detecting Leaks Before They Devastate: Preventive Measures

A proactive approach to leak detection is crucial for safeguarding your property and finances. Regular audits of plumbing systems, water heaters, and appliances can reveal subtle signs of trouble before they escalate into major disasters. By utilizing preventative measures like routine maintenance and repairs, you can minimize the risk of costly leaks and problems.
